+23
−5
+13
−0
Loading
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more
Board config works slightly differently from product config. It requires the product config variables to be passed into it. Currently the only generic way to pass info into an RBC script is via the arguments to rbcrun, which get passed as global variables, not the product (cfg) variables. Add a new form of launcher that reads the product variables from a separate rbc file that is generated in make. The board configuration also doesn't need inheritance, so it doesn't call rblf.product_configuration() either. Bug: 201700692 Test: build/bazel/ci/rbc_product_config.sh -b sdk_phone_x86_64-userdebug Change-Id: I52fd65b33cf99b45a563284e2849da75a8af8688